Chocolately Walnut Vegan Cookies.

Here’s the recipe – they’re easy to make, but super addictive!
What You’ll Need:
1 stick vegan margarine
1/2 cup brown sugar
3/4 cup white sugar
2 tablespoons ground flaxseed + 6 tablespoons of water…mix together, let sit for 2 mins = 2 eggs!
2 and 1/4 cups flour
splash of vanilla
splash of baking soda (ok, I guess baking soda doesn’t actually “splash,” but you get the idea)
splash of salt (see above.) (splash = I don’t measure)
bag of vegan chocolate chippies
1 cup of walnuts
What you’ll do:
-Preheat oven to 375
-Melt margarine in pan
-Whisk sugars, egg mixture, vanilla, and melted margarine into a nice big bowl
-In a smaller bowl, whisk flour, baking soda, and salt.
-Mix dry ingredients into wet ingredients.
-Stir chippies and nuts into mix. Get everything nice and covered but don’t overmix.
-Line baking sheets w/ parchment paper. Wet hands slightly and roll mixture into balls.
-I think I made mine smaller than usual because it made about 45 cookies and each one was oozing with chocolate. I preferred it this way! They weren’t that small, plus there were more cookies! (I think it’s normally like 30?)
-I used 3 baking trays. (2 at a time, then 1 more)
-Cook for about 15 mins…possibly a little less, depending on how you like them.
-If you want to keep your cookies soft, keep a piece of bread in there with the cookies. I take a piece of bread and rip it into chunks, spreading it around. The bread soaks up any moisture, so the bread gets all hard and the cookies stay soft! Doubles as a cool magic trick.
